Equipped to meet the needs of modern-day travelers, Norbiton Station offers an array of amenities. For those seeking tickets, the ticket office is open from 06:40 to 20:25 on weekdays, slightly differing hours on weekends, and is supported by ticket machines that also cater to users with disabilities. Though staff help isn’t available in person at the station, assistance can be secured via guards on the trains—ensuring that accessibility needs aren't overlooked. The waiting room on Platform 1 is heated and offers seating compliant with accessibility codes, adding a touch of comfort while you wait.
Norbiton extends its service beyond the tracks with convenient transport links, including rail replacement services off Coombe Road, should they be needed. For those looking to undertake further travel via the local bus network, you can plan your continued journey here. Unfortunately, the station itself does not provide cycle hire facilities or a car park operator, although ample bicycle storage with CCTV is available for the active traveler.

Offering step-free access to parts of the station, Yoker train station ensures comfort and ease for all passengers. Although it lacks a ticket office, it compensates with ticket machines where you can purchase and collect pre-bought tickets — a boon for modern travelers who enjoy the convenience of online bookings. The station is equipped with smartcard validators, and induction loops cater to those with hearing impairments. A help point on Platform 1 serves as the central hub for passenger assistance, while customer information is readily available through departure screens and announcements.
While Yoker does not offer staff assistance or accessible car parking facilities, it maintains customer help points and a seating area for comfort while you wait for your train. It remains an essential transit point without excessive frills but with substantial benefits for the daily commuter.
If you’re planning to continue your journey by bus, you can find bus services that pick up and drop off at the station car park at Platform 2. Detailed service information is accessible online at Traveline Scotland. For taxi services, the www.traintaxi.co.uk site is your go-to resource for finding available hire options.
